Ingredients for making Rye Sandwich bread
- Fresh Milled Rye Flour – The whole grain flour gives amazing flavor and nutrition to this bread.
- Water – For best results, use filtered water. Warmed to 195-205 degrees F.
- Instant Yeast – Instant yeast makes for the easiest bread recipes, especially for beginners.
- Salt – I prefer to use fine sea salt.
- Caraway Seeds – Optional, add 1 tsp.
For a seeded loaf, add 1 tablespoon of sunflower seeds and 1 tablespoon of sesame seeds.

Step-by-step process for making this no knead rye bread recipe
Mill the rye berries
Mill your berries on the fine setting of your GRAIN MILL.
Mix the dough
In a small pot, warm your water to 195-200 degrees F.
In a large mixing bowl, add the warm water, flour, yeast, and salt.
Note: If you only have active dry yeast on hand, stir into the warmed water, cover, and let sit for 5-10 minutes until foamy before add to flour and salt.
Mix the dough until well combined with a wooden spoon or dough whisk. This is a very sticky and wet dough.
Sit aside and prepare a LOAF PAN by spraying with olive oil or lining with a piece of parchment paper and lightly spraying with oil.
Use a rubber spatula and scoop the batter into the loaf pan. Even out the dough with the spatula.

Let the dough rise (Bulk Fermentation)
Cover with plastic wrap or a damp tea towel and let rise for 1 1/2-2 hours at room temperature or until the dough is nearing the edge of the bread pan or just comes above the edge of the pan.
Keep in mind you will not see the super high rise with this bread recipe that is typical when using all purpose or bread flour.
Bake the bread
Preheat the oven temperature to 350 degrees F at the end of the rising time.
Optionally, brush the top of the dough with an egg wash for a deeply browned crust.
Bake the loaf in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es or until an instant-read thermometer reads the internal temperature to be 200-205 degrees F in the center of the loaf and it is lightly golden brown.
Let the bread cool completely on a wire rack before slicing. (If you can wait!)

Storage Tips
Store the sliced loaf in a bread bag, plastic bag, or airtight container on the counter for 2-3 days.
Freeze the sliced loaf in a freezer safe bag for up to 3 months.

100% Rye Sandwich Bread Recipe (Simple No Knead Loaf)
Equipment
- 8.5×4.5 loaf pan
Ingredients
- 2 3/4 cup Fresh Milled Rye Flour (350 grams)
- 1 1/4 cup Warm Water (300 grams)
- 2 1/4 tsp Instant Yeast (5 grams)
- 1 1/2 tsp Salt (5 grams)
Instructions
- Mill your rye berries in a grain mill on the fine setting.
- In a small pot, warm the water to about 195 degrees F.
- In a large mixing bowl, add the warm water, the flour, the salt, and the instant yeast.
- Mix until well combined. This will be a very sticky dough.
- Prepare a loaf pan by spraying with oil or lining with a piece of parchment paper lightly sprayed with oil.
- Using a rubber spatula, scoop the dough into the prepared loaf pan and spread out evenly in the pan.
- Cover with plastic wrap or a damp tea towel and let rise for 1 1/2 – 2 hours or until the dough is nearing the edge of the pan.
- Keep in mind, this bread will not have the super high rise you get with bread made with all purpose flour or bread flour.
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
- Bake the loaf for 35-40 minutes or until the internal temperature is 200-205 degrees F read with an instant read thermometer.
- Allow the bread to cool completely before slicing.
